ssh: Remove redundant socket path from `testCloneAndPush()`
The `testCloneAndPush()` funciton accepts the socket path of the server
it shall connect to as parameter. This is redundant though given that we
already pass the `config.Cfg` of the server.
Remove the redundant parameter.
